The foreign aid policies of France to Africa have experienced a procedure of constant development and transformation.After the Second World War,African countries have launched national independence movements and have got rid of the shackles of former colonial powers,such as France.France,suffered a major blow during the war,and its first priority was to continue to maintain relations with the former colonies in order to restore its great-power status.Therefore,each government of France has put the Franco-African relationship,especially the relationship with french-speaking African countries,on a high priority.And the foreign aid is considered as one of the most important ways.In recent years,African countries have enjoyed political stability and rapid economic growth,and Africa has become the focus of competition among great powers.Confronted with the fierce competition in Africa,France has accelerated its adjustment of aid policies to Africa to maintain its traditional dominance,and there are still numerous challenges and obstacles which merit a closer look and in-depth study.At the same time,China-Africa relations have become an important part of China's diplomatic strategy.Relations between China and Africa have warmed up in recent years.Understanding the development of France's aid policies towards Africa is of great significance for developing China-Africa relations.This thesis is divided into five parts.The introduction consists of the purpose and significance of the research,literature review,methodology,innovations and difficulties.The first chapter teases out the development of France's aid policies to Africa before the cold war,and summarizes the characteristics in evolution of the four governments as Charles de Gaulle,Pompidou,Destan and Mitterrand.The second chapter is the key chapter of the full thesis,which analyzes the reasons,contents and influences of theadjustments of France's aid policies to Africa after the Cold War.The third chapter demonstrates the unique characteristics of the aid policy adjustments based on the first two chapters with concrete examples.The final chapter analyzes the challenges France was confronted with in order to put forward some suggestions and predicts the future direction of Franco-African relations,finally it provides the enlightenment and constructive suggestions on the development of Chinese foreign aid to Africa.
